Web31 jul. 2024 · SISTER The most common Filipino word for “sister” is áte, although this is used for women who are older than the speaker. Tagalog, like most Austronesian languages, is gender-neutral.The third-person pronoun siya is used for both "he" and "she", as well as "it" in the context of being a neuter gender. It is one of the most simple classificatory systems of kinship.
